Output 891a6c7cc3f56f6d2cf27dfbf14539abd9c9ad19289dab39b69f19c1e3aac8d1:0

value
149256892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e5296f10eb999870cc578fbdbc8c91c3e5ce23 OP_EQUAL
address
323cUZeqyiBWnNyzPqqWW1Z5h6B2RD8ktM
transaction
891a6c7cc3f56f6d2cf27dfbf14539abd9c9ad19289dab39b69f19c1e3aac8d1
spent
true